And for tenants, leasing farmland is an opportunity to start your own farm when you don\u2019t yet have the funds to purchase your own property.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The process and termination of farmland leases can be tricky at times, though. So, it\u2019s important to know your rights as a landowner and as a tenant.\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><em>There are two main types of leases: written and verbal.\u00a0<\/em><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Many farmland leases in <a href=\"https:\/\/nationalland.com\/land-for-sale-in-nebraska\">Nebraska<\/a> are verbal. And most of those verbal farm leases are between family members. This means that the family members entered into an unwritten or \u201chandshake\u201d agreement for leasing the farmland. People usually prefer this lease method because they don\u2019t feel the need to enter into a legal contract with a family member they feel they can fully trust.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">However, a verbal lease between individuals, especially families, can pose some problems whenever the tenant decides they want to end the lease. The most common legal problem that comes with verbal leases is how a farmland lease can legally be terminated. Legal issues over verbal farm leases can take a toll on the relationship between family members and lead to a never-ending battle.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">According to an article by J. David Aiken, Water &amp; Agricultural Law Specialist at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ln, \u201cfor unwritten leases, six months advance notice must be given to legally terminate the lease.\u201d<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Written farmland leases are just that, written. For these, termination guidelines are clearly stated in the written lease. \u201cIf nothing is specified, a written lease terminates automatically on the last day of the lease with no automatic renewal,\u201d according to the article by Aiken.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">So, before you enter into a farm lease, whether you\u2019re a landowner or a potential tenant, make sure you\u2019re taking the right steps to make it easier for yourself in the future.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Readers should not act upon the information contained in these materials without legal guidance.
